// SPDX-FileCopyrightText: Copyright 2023 The Minder Authors
// SPDX-License-Identifier: Apache-2.0
package controlplane
import (
"context"
"crypto/rand"
"database/sql"
"encoding/hex"
"errors"
"net/http"
"path"
"strconv"
"strings"
"github.com/google/uuid"
gauth "github.com/grpc-ecosystem/go-grpc-middleware/v2/interceptors/auth"
"github.com/rs/zerolog"
"google.golang.org/grpc/codes"
"google.golang.org/grpc/status"
"google.golang.org/protobuf/types/known/timestamppb"
"github.com/mindersec/minder/internal/auth"
"github.com/mindersec/minder/internal/auth/jwt"
"github.com/mindersec/minder/internal/authz"
"github.com/mindersec/minder/internal/db"
"github.com/mindersec/minder/internal/logger"
"github.com/mindersec/minder/internal/projects"
"github.com/mindersec/minder/internal/util"
pb "github.com/mindersec/minder/pkg/api/protobuf/go/minder/v1"
)
// CreateUser is a service for user self registration
func (s *Server) CreateUser(ctx context.Context,
_ *pb.CreateUserRequest) (*pb.CreateUserResponse, error) {
tokenString, err := gauth.AuthFromMD(ctx, "bearer")
if err != nil {
return nil, status.Errorf(codes.InvalidArgument, "no auth token: %v", err)
}
token, err := s.jwt.ParseAndValidate(tokenString)
if err != nil {
return nil, status.Errorf(codes.Unauthenticated, "failed to parse bearer token: %v", err)
}
tx, err := s.store.BeginTransaction()
if err != nil {
return nil, status.Errorf(codes.Internal, "failed to begin transaction")
}
defer s.store.Rollback(tx)
qtx := s.store.GetQuerierWithTransaction(tx)
if qtx == nil {
return nil, status.Errorf(codes.Internal, "failed to get transaction")
}
subject := token.Subject()
user, err := qtx.CreateUser(ctx, subject)
if err != nil {
return nil, status.Errorf(codes.Internal, "failed to create user: %s", err)
}
var userProjects []*db.Project
userProjects = append(userProjects, s.claimGitHubInstalls(ctx, qtx)...)
if len(userProjects) == 0 {
// Set up the default project for the user
baseName := subject
if token.PreferredUsername() != "" {
// Ensure there's no existing project with that name. In case there is, we will append a
// random string to the project name. This is a temporary solution until we have a better
// way to handle this, i.e. this should happen separately from user creation.
baseName, err = getUniqueProjectBaseName(ctx, s.store, token.PreferredUsername())
if err != nil {
return nil, status.Errorf(codes.Internal, "failed to get unique project name: %s", err)
}
}
project, err := s.projectCreator.ProvisionSelfEnrolledProject(
ctx,
qtx,
baseName,
subject,
)
if err != nil {
if errors.Is(err, projects.ErrProjectAlreadyExists) {
return nil, util.UserVisibleError(codes.AlreadyExists, "project named %s already exists", baseName)
}
return nil, status.Errorf(codes.Internal, "failed to create default organization records: %s", err)
}
userProjects = append(userProjects, project)
}
// Telemetry logging
logger.BusinessRecord(ctx).Project = userProjects[0].ID
err = s.store.Commit(tx)
if err != nil {
return nil, status.Errorf(codes.Internal, "failed to commit transaction: %s", err)
}
if len(userProjects) == 0 {
return nil, status.Errorf(codes.Internal, "failed to create any projects for user")
}
return &pb.CreateUserResponse{
Id: user.ID,
ProjectId: userProjects[0].ID.String(),
ProjectName: userProjects[0].Name,
IdentitySubject: user.IdentitySubject,
CreatedAt: timestamppb.New(user.CreatedAt),
}, nil
}
func (s *Server) claimGitHubInstalls(ctx context.Context, qtx db.ExtendQuerier) []*db.Project {
ghId, ok := jwt.GetUserClaimFromContext[string](ctx, "gh_id")
if !ok || ghId == "" {
return nil
}
installs, err := qtx.GetUnclaimedInstallationsByUser(ctx, sql.NullString{String: ghId, Valid: true})
if err != nil {
zerolog.Ctx(ctx).Error().Err(err).Str("gh_id", ghId).Msg("failed to get unclaimed installations")
return nil
}
userID, err := strconv.ParseInt(ghId, 10, 64)
if err != nil {
zerolog.Ctx(ctx).Error().Err(err).Str("gh_id", ghId).Msg("failed to parse gh_id")
return nil
}
var userProjects []*db.Project
for _, i := range installs {
// TODO: if we can get an GitHub auth token for the user, we can do the rest with CreateGitHubAppWithoutInvitation
proj, dbProv, err := s.ghProviders.CreateGitHubAppWithoutInvitation(ctx, qtx, userID, i.AppInstallationID)
if err != nil {
zerolog.Ctx(ctx).Error().Err(err).Int64("org_id", i.OrganizationID).Msg("failed to create GitHub app at first login")
continue
}
if dbProv != nil {
login := strings.TrimPrefix(dbProv.Name, string(db.ProviderClassGithubApp)+"-")
s.publishOrganizationEntityEvent(ctx, dbProv.ID, proj.ID, login)
}
if proj != nil {
userProjects = append(userProjects, proj)
}
}
return userProjects
}
// DeleteUser is a service for user self deletion
func (s *Server) DeleteUser(ctx context.Context,
_ *pb.DeleteUserRequest) (*pb.DeleteUserResponse, error) {
tokenString, err := gauth.AuthFromMD(ctx, "bearer")
if err != nil {
return nil, status.Errorf(codes.InvalidArgument, "no auth token: %v", err)
}
token, err := s.jwt.ParseAndValidate(tokenString)
if err != nil {
return nil, status.Errorf(codes.Unauthenticated, "failed to parse bearer token: %v", err)
}
subject := token.Subject()
err = DeleteUser(ctx, s.store, s.authzClient, s.projectDeleter, subject)
if err != nil {
return nil, status.Errorf(codes.Internal, "failed to delete user from database: %v", err)
}
resp, err := s.cfg.Identity.Server.AdminDo(ctx, "DELETE", path.Join("users", subject), nil, nil)
if err != nil {
return nil, status.Errorf(codes.Internal, "failed to delete account on IdP: %v", err)
}
defer resp.Body.Close()
if resp.StatusCode != http.StatusNoContent {
return nil, status.Errorf(codes.Internal, "unexpected status code when deleting account: %d", resp.StatusCode)
}
return &pb.DeleteUserResponse{}, nil
}
func (s *Server) getUserDependencies(ctx context.Context, user db.User) ([]*pb.ProjectRole, []*pb.Project, error) {
// get all the projects associated with that user
projs, err := s.authzClient.ProjectsForUser(ctx, user.IdentitySubject)
if err != nil {
return nil, nil, err
}
var projectRoles []*pb.ProjectRole
var deprecatedPrjs []*pb.Project
for _, proj := range projs {
pinfo, err := s.store.GetProjectByID(ctx, proj)
if err != nil {
// if the project was deleted while iterating, skip it
if errors.Is(err, sql.ErrNoRows) {
continue
}
return nil, nil, err
}
// Try to parse the project metadata to complete the response fields
pDisplay := pinfo.Name
pDescr := ""
meta, err := projects.ParseMetadata(&pinfo)
if err == nil {
pDisplay = meta.Public.DisplayName
pDescr = meta.Public.Description
}
// Get all role assignments for this project
as, err := s.authzClient.AssignmentsToProject(ctx, proj)
if err != nil {
return nil, nil, status.Errorf(codes.Internal, "error getting role assignments: %v", err)
}
// TODO: Delete once all use ProjectRoles
deprecatedPrjs = append(deprecatedPrjs, &pb.Project{
ProjectId: proj.String(),
Name: pinfo.Name,
CreatedAt: timestamppb.New(pinfo.CreatedAt),
UpdatedAt: timestamppb.New(pinfo.UpdatedAt),
DisplayName: pDisplay,
Description: pDescr,
})
var projectRole *pb.Role
if len(as) != 0 {
// Find the role for the user
var roleString string
for _, a := range as {
if a.Subject == user.IdentitySubject {
roleString = a.Role
}
}
// Parse role
authzRole, err := authz.ParseRole(roleString)
if err != nil {
return nil, nil, status.Errorf(codes.Internal, "failed to parse role: %v", err)
}
projectRole = &pb.Role{
Name: authzRole.String(),
DisplayName: authz.AllRolesDisplayName[authzRole],
Description: authz.AllRolesDescriptions[authzRole],
}
}
// Append the project role to the response
projectRoles = append(projectRoles, &pb.ProjectRole{
Role: projectRole,
Project: &pb.Project{
ProjectId: proj.String(),
Name: pinfo.Name,
CreatedAt: timestamppb.New(pinfo.CreatedAt),
UpdatedAt: timestamppb.New(pinfo.UpdatedAt),
DisplayName: pDisplay,
Description: pDescr,
},
})
}
return projectRoles, deprecatedPrjs, nil
}
// GetUser is a service for getting personal user details
func (s *Server) GetUser(ctx context.Context, _ *pb.GetUserRequest) (*pb.GetUserResponse, error) {
// user is always authorized to get themselves
tokenString, err := gauth.AuthFromMD(ctx, "bearer")
if err != nil {
return nil, status.Errorf(codes.InvalidArgument, "no auth token: %v", err)
}
openIdToken, err := s.jwt.ParseAndValidate(tokenString)
if err != nil {
return nil, status.Errorf(codes.Unauthenticated, "failed to parse bearer token: %v", err)
}
// check if user exists
user, err := s.store.GetUserBySubject(ctx, openIdToken.Subject())
if err != nil {
if errors.Is(err, sql.ErrNoRows) {
return nil, status.Error(codes.NotFound, "user not found")
}
return nil, status.Errorf(codes.Internal, "failed to get user: %s", err)
}
var resp pb.GetUserResponse
resp.User = &pb.UserRecord{
Id: user.ID,
IdentitySubject: user.IdentitySubject,
CreatedAt: timestamppb.New(user.CreatedAt),
UpdatedAt: timestamppb.New(user.UpdatedAt),
}
projectRoles, deprecatedPrjs, err := s.getUserDependencies(ctx, user)
if err != nil {
return nil, status.Errorf(codes.Unknown, "failed to get user dependencies: %s", err)
}
resp.ProjectRoles = projectRoles
// nolint: staticcheck
resp.Projects = deprecatedPrjs
return &resp, nil
}
// ListInvitations is a service for listing invitations.
func (s *Server) ListInvitations(ctx context.Context, _ *pb.ListInvitationsRequest) (*pb.ListInvitationsResponse, error) {
invitations, err := s.invites.GetInvitesForSelf(ctx, s.store, s.idClient)
if err != nil {
return nil, err
}
return &pb.ListInvitationsResponse{
Invitations: invitations,
}, nil
}
// ResolveInvitation is a service for resolving an invitation.
func (s *Server) ResolveInvitation(ctx context.Context, req *pb.ResolveInvitationRequest) (*pb.ResolveInvitationResponse, error) {
tx, err := s.store.BeginTransaction()
if err != nil {
return nil, status.Errorf(codes.Internal, "failed to begin transaction")
}
defer s.store.Rollback(tx)
qtx := s.store.GetQuerierWithTransaction(tx)
if qtx == nil {
return nil, status.Errorf(codes.Internal, "failed to get transaction")
}
invite, err := s.invites.GetInvite(ctx, qtx, req.Code)
if err != nil || invite == nil {
return nil, err
}
project, err := uuid.Parse(invite.GetProject())
if err != nil {
return nil, status.Errorf(codes.Internal, "failed to parse project ID: %s", err)
}
// Accept invitation
if req.Accept {
_, err := ensureUser(ctx, s, qtx)
if err != nil {
return nil, status.Errorf(codes.Internal, "failed to get or create user: %s", err)
}
if err := s.acceptInvitation(ctx, project, invite); err != nil {
return nil, err
}
}
// Delete the invitation since its resolved
err = s.invites.RemoveInvite(ctx, qtx, req.Code)
if err != nil {
return nil, status.Errorf(codes.Internal, "failed to delete invitation: %s", err)
}
// Resolve the project's display name
targetProject, err := qtx.GetProjectByID(ctx, project)
if err != nil {
return nil, status.Errorf(codes.Internal, "failed to get project: %s", err)
}
err = s.store.Commit(tx)
if err != nil {
return nil, status.Errorf(codes.Internal, "failed to commit transaction: %s", err)
}
// Parse the project metadata, so we can get the display name set by project owner
meta, err := projects.ParseMetadata(&targetProject)
if err != nil {
return nil, status.Errorf(codes.Internal, "error parsing project metadata: %v", err)
}
return &pb.ResolveInvitationResponse{
Role: invite.GetRole(),
Project: invite.GetProject(),
ProjectDisplay: meta.Public.DisplayName,
Email: invite.GetEmail(),
IsAccepted: req.Accept,
}, nil
}
func (s *Server) acceptInvitation(ctx context.Context, projectID uuid.UUID, userInvite *pb.Invitation) error {
// Validate in case there's an existing role assignment for the user
as, err := s.authzClient.AssignmentsToProject(ctx, projectID)
if err != nil {
return status.Errorf(codes.Internal, "error getting role assignments: %v", err)
}
// Loop through all role assignments for the project and check if this user already has a role
currentUser := auth.IdentityFromContext(ctx).String()
for _, existing := range as {
if existing.Subject == currentUser {
// User already has the same role in the project
if existing.Role == userInvite.Role {
return util.UserVisibleError(codes.AlreadyExists, "user already has the same role in the project")
}
// Revoke the existing role assignments for the user in the project
existingRole, err := authz.ParseRole(existing.Role)
if err != nil {
return status.Errorf(codes.Internal, "failed to parse existing role: %s", err)
}
existingProject, err := uuid.Parse(*existing.Project)
if err != nil {
return status.Errorf(codes.Internal, "failed to parse existing project: %s", err)
}
// Delete the role assignment
if err := s.authzClient.Delete(
ctx,
currentUser,
existingRole,
existingProject,
); err != nil {
return status.Errorf(codes.Internal, "error writing role assignment: %v", err)
}
}
}
// Parse the role
authzRole, err := authz.ParseRole(userInvite.Role)
if err != nil {
return status.Errorf(codes.Internal, "failed to parse invitation role: %s", err)
}
// Add the user to the project
if err := s.authzClient.Write(ctx, currentUser, authzRole, projectID); err != nil {
return status.Errorf(codes.Internal, "error writing role assignment: %v", err)
}
return nil
}
func ensureUser(ctx context.Context, s *Server, store db.ExtendQuerier) (db.User, error) {
id := auth.IdentityFromContext(ctx)
sub := id.String()
if sub == "" {
return db.User{}, status.Error(codes.Internal, "failed to get user subject")
}
// Get the user by the subject
user, err := store.GetUserBySubject(ctx, sub)
if err == nil {
return user, nil
}
// Create a user if necessary, see https://github.com/mindersec/minder/pull/3837/files#r1674108001
if errors.Is(err, sql.ErrNoRows) {
user, err := store.CreateUser(ctx, sub)
if err != nil {
return db.User{}, status.Errorf(codes.Internal, "failed to create user: %s", err)
}
// If we create a new user, we should see if they have outstanding GitHub installations
// to create projects for.
s.claimGitHubInstalls(ctx, store)
return user, err
}
return db.User{}, err
}
// generateRandomString is used to generate a random string of a given length
func generateRandomString(length int) (string, error) {
bytes := make([]byte, length)
_, err := rand.Read(bytes)
if err != nil {
return "", err
}
return hex.EncodeToString(bytes)[:length], nil
}
// getUniqueProjectBaseName is used to generate a unique project name
func getUniqueProjectBaseName(ctx context.Context, store db.Store, baseName string) (string, error) {
const maxRetries = 10
retryCount := 0
uniqueBaseName := baseName
for retryCount < maxRetries {
_, err := store.GetProjectByName(ctx, uniqueBaseName)
if err != nil {
if errors.Is(err, sql.ErrNoRows) {
return uniqueBaseName, nil
}
return "", status.Errorf(codes.Internal, "failed to get project by name: %s", err)
}
r, err := generateRandomString(4)
if err != nil {
return "", status.Errorf(codes.Internal, "failed to generate random string: %s", err)
}
uniqueBaseName = baseName + "-" + r
retryCount++
}
return "", status.Errorf(codes.ResourceExhausted, "failed to generate a unique project base name after %d attempts", maxRetries)
}
